Get Ready For The $16.50 Bagel, New York
If you’ve never heard of Eleven Madison Park, all you need to know is that it’s a Michelin starred, multiple award-winning super expensive restaurant.
And now its own Daniel Humm is getting in the bagel game, as Eaterrevealed.
Black Seed (a New York artisanal bagel bakery) continues its monthly bagel partnership series, and this time they’ve hooked chef Daniel Humm for their next venture. Daniel Humm’s June bagel creation is a celery seed bagel with black truffle cream cheese, smoked sturgeon, pickled celery root, pickled shallots, and thinly sliced celery.
But all that sturgeon ain’t cheap. We’re talking about $16.50 a bagel. I guess that’s just the price of art.
I mean, it has nothing on the $1,000 gold-flecked bagel of tabloid fame, but still.
